Nice People at Chevy Chase Acura but They would not sell me a 2023 Integra that did not have a $1,000+ protection package and their MSRP pricing was contingent of using Acura's Financing. They were straight forward but not willing to budge to meet me somewhere in the middle. I was willing to either do the financing or the extra protection package but not both. I went in to quickly put a deposit down on a vehicle but we couldn't come to an agreement and it was a waste of my time to be fair a waste of their time too. I found more negotiable dealerships in Virginia that let me use outside financing, not add any extras, and not charging an MSRP adjustment. To be transparent buying a car on VA I believe the standard processing fee is around $500 higher. Adding protection packages that are not requested and making financing through Acura in my opinion is just a backwards way to raise the price. I understand that cars are in low supply right now but did Walmart raise the price of Toilet Paper when supply chains were strained.

I've bought a lot of cars over the years and I've walked out on more salesman than I can count. We went through the Costco car buying program which is unique in that they only work with dealerships that meet their requirements. Not sure what that means, but I do know that none of the dealerships I have found to be grimy were not available through their program so I assume that is why Chevy Chase Acura was on their list and I had such a fantastic experience. Here's the bottom line. I go into a dealership expecting to have to go over every single line of every single document to uncover what they are trying to slip in there just to get to the finance officer which is where the real fight begins. I get it, they are there to make money, but I hate the game that is played. There was absolutely no gamesmanship, no hidden costs, no pressure to upsale, no headaches at all. The only thing that we had to "work out" was the value of my trade-in and that literally took minutes. Giovanni was our finance officer and we were done in about 15 minutes and it may have been faster if I hadn't screwed up my salary information on the credit application. The biggest thing is that I bought this vehicle (2022 MDX) just weeks after it was released and its selling like crazy. Dealerships cannot keep them on the lots. Anyone in the market right now knows that the supply issue is screwing up prices and many dealerships from other brands are marking up their vehicles because demand is greater than supply. We were looking at the Telluride which is a lot of vehicle for about $47K. Local dealerships are trying to sell them for $59K because of the situation right now and they refuse to negotiate. I don't know if our experience was unique because of the Costco program, but this is the first place we're going when we look for our next vehicle.
